Text: LFPAK The Toughest Power-SO8 The evolution of Power MOSFET packages Typical TO220 construction TO220 is the ‘original’ through-hole power package. It is suitable for through-hole mounting and low-cost wave soldering. It also provides very low thermal resistances when mounted to a suitable heatsink.
